首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

替换R中的反斜杠

在R语言中,可以使用反斜杠(\)来进行转义,以表示特殊字符或符号。要替换R中的反斜杠,可以使用字符串函数gsub()来实现。

下面是一个示例代码,展示如何替换R中的反斜杠:

代码语言:txt
复制
# 导入stringr包
library(stringr)

# 定义一个包含反斜杠的字符串
str <- "C:\\Program Files\\R\\bin"

# 使用gsub函数替换反斜杠为正斜杠
str_replace_all(str, "\\\\", "/")

在上述示例中,我们使用str_replace_all()函数将反斜杠(\)替换为正斜杠(/)。需要注意的是,在R语言中,由于反斜杠是转义字符,所以在正则表达式中需要使用两个反斜杠(\\)来表示一个反斜杠。

替换后的结果将返回一个新的字符串,其中反斜杠被替换为正斜杠。对于上述示例来说,替换后的结果将是:"C:/Program Files/R/bin"。

这样的替换操作在处理文件路径时很常见。例如,如果你想在R中读取一个文件,可以使用上述替换操作来正确解析文件路径。

对应腾讯云相关产品,由于不能提及具体的品牌商,请自行参考腾讯云的文档和产品介绍页面,了解腾讯云所提供的云计算相关产品和解决方案,以满足你的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Python:爬虫系列笔记(6) -- 正则化表达(推荐)

    在前面我们已经搞定了怎样获取页面的内容,不过还差一步,这么多杂乱的代码夹杂文字我们怎样把它提取出来整理呢?下面就开始介绍一个十分强大的工具,正则表达式! 1.了解正则表达式 正则表达式是对字符串操作的一种逻辑公式,就是用事先定义好的一些特定字符、及这些特定字符的组合,组成一个“规则字符串”,这个“规则字符串”用来表达对字符串的一种过滤逻辑。 正则表达式是用来匹配字符串非常强大的工具,在其他编程语言中同样有正则表达式的概念,Python同样不例外,利用了正则表达式,我们想要从返回的页面内容提取出我们想要的内容

    08
    领券